news 2026/4/3 14:20:05

Z-Image-Turbo_UI界面历史图片管理技巧,方便查看删除

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Z-Image-Turbo_UI界面历史图片管理技巧,方便查看删除

Z-Image-Turbo_UI界面历史图片管理技巧,方便查看删除

在使用 Z-Image-Turbo 的 UI 界面过程中,你是否遇到过这些情况:
生成了十几张图,却找不到上次那张满意的猫图?
想清理磁盘空间,但不确定哪些是旧图、哪些是待用稿?
朋友问“你刚生成的赛博朋克海报在哪”,你翻遍文件夹却只看到一串001.png002.png

别担心——这不是你的操作问题,而是缺少一套清晰、可控、不依赖记忆的历史图片管理方法
本文不讲模型原理、不调参数、不编译源码,只聚焦一个高频刚需:如何在 Z-Image-Turbo_UI 界面中,快速查看、精准定位、安全删除历史生成的图片。所有操作均基于官方镜像默认路径与标准命令,无需额外安装、不改代码、不碰配置,开箱即用。


1. 明确历史图片的物理存放位置

Z-Image-Turbo_UI 默认将所有生成图片统一保存在固定路径下。这个路径不是隐藏的,也不是随机的,而是一个可预测、可访问、可直接操作的标准目录。

1.1 默认输出路径解析

当你通过浏览器访问http://localhost:7860并完成一次图像生成后,图片并非仅显示在网页上——它已被真实写入本地文件系统。具体位置为:

~/workspace/output_image/

这个路径中的~表示当前用户的主目录(例如 Linux/macOS 下是/home/username,在 CSDN 星图等云环境里通常指向/root/workspace根目录)。
关键点在于:该路径是硬编码在 UI 启动脚本中的默认输出目录,所有生成行为都指向这里,无需手动指定

小贴士:为什么不是./outputimages/这类常见路径?因为~/workspace/output_image/是镜像预置环境专为稳定性设计的标准化路径——它被赋予了完整读写权限,且不会因 Gradio 临时缓存机制被意外清理。

1.2 验证路径是否存在且有内容

最直接的方式是打开终端(或镜像内置的 Web Terminal),执行以下命令:

ls -la ~/workspace/output_image/

如果已生成过图片,你会看到类似输出:

total 12456 drwxr-xr-x 2 root root 4096 Jan 28 15:32 . drwxr-xr-x 6 root root 4096 Jan 28 14:20 .. -rw-r--r-- 1 root root 2145892 Jan 28 15:28 001.png -rw-r--r-- 1 root root 2098765 Jan 28 15:30 002.png -rw-r--r-- 1 root root 2210341 Jan 28 15:31 003.png

每行代表一张 PNG 图片,文件名按生成顺序递增(部分镜像版本可能带时间戳前缀,但规律一致)。
若提示No such file or directory,说明尚未生成任何图片,或镜像未按标准路径写入——此时请先运行一次单图生成,再重试该命令。


2. 三种高效查看历史图片的方法

光知道路径还不够。面对几十甚至上百张图,靠ls列表显然低效。下面介绍三种渐进式查看方案,从基础到直观,适配不同使用习惯。

2.1 终端命令行快速浏览(适合确认存在性与命名规则)

这是最快捷的“存在性验证”方式,尤其适合远程连接或无图形界面场景:

# 查看最近5张图(按修改时间倒序) ls -t ~/workspace/output_image/*.png | head -n 5 # 查看所有图的大小和生成时间(便于识别大图/旧图) ls -ltsh ~/workspace/output_image/*.png

输出示例:

2.1M -rw-r--r-- 1 root root 2145892 Jan 28 15:28 001.png 2.0M -rw-r--r-- 1 root root 2098765 Jan 28 15:30 002.png 2.2M -rw-r--r-- 1 root root 2210341 Jan 28 15:31 003.png

优势:零延迟、可管道处理、支持筛选(如| grep "cat"
局限:无法预览图像内容,纯文本信息密度低

2.2 文件管理器可视化打开(适合批量筛选与拖拽操作)

如果你使用的镜像是带桌面环境的(如 CSDN 星图部分镜像),或可通过 VNC 访问图形界面,推荐直接打开文件管理器:

  1. 打开文件管理器(如 Nautilus、Thunar 或 Windows 资源管理器映射)
  2. 地址栏输入:/root/workspace/output_image/(Linux)或/workspace/output_image/(云环境常见路径)
  3. 切换为「图标视图」或「缩略图模式」

此时你将看到所有图片以缩略图形式排列,可直接:

  • 拖拽排序(按名称、日期、大小)
  • Ctrl+A全选后右键 → “属性” 查看总占用空间
  • 双击任意图片用默认看图器打开,快速比对细节

优势:所见即所得、支持多图并排对比、操作符合直觉
局限:依赖图形界面,云环境需确认是否启用桌面服务

2.3 浏览器内嵌画廊(UI 原生支持,最贴近工作流)

Z-Image-Turbo_UI 的 Gradio 界面本身已集成历史画廊功能——它不是第三方插件,而是zimage_gui.pyget_history_gallery()函数实时读取~/workspace/output_image/目录生成的。

操作路径如下:

  1. 在浏览器中打开http://localhost:7860
  2. 点击顶部 Tab 栏中的“生成历史”
  3. 页面自动加载最近 50 张图(按修改时间倒序,最新在左上角)

该画廊具备以下实用特性:

  • 点击任意缩略图 → 自动在右侧弹出高清预览(原图尺寸)
  • 鼠标悬停缩略图 → 显示完整文件名(如cyberpunk_city_017.png
  • 支持横向滚动浏览,无分页跳转
  • 底部有「刷新历史」按钮,应对新图未即时显示的情况

对比发现:UI 画廊展示的是~/workspace/output_image/的实时快照,与终端ls结果完全一致。这意味着——你在画廊里看到的,就是你真正能删、能导出、能分享的原始文件


3. 安全删除历史图片的实操指南

查看是为了决策,而决策常指向清理。删除操作必须兼顾效率、精准、防误删三重目标。以下是经过验证的三种删除策略,按风险由低到高排列。

3.1 单张精准删除(推荐日常使用)

当你明确知道要删哪一张时,这是最安全的方式:

# 进入图片目录(养成习惯,避免误删其他文件) cd ~/workspace/output_image/ # 删除指定文件(务必核对文件名!) rm -f 003.png # 或更稳妥:先用 ls 确认,再删除 ls -l 003.png # 看一眼是否真要删 rm -f 003.png

为什么安全?

  • -f参数避免交互式确认,但仅作用于目标文件,不影响其他
  • 不涉及通配符*,杜绝“删错目录”的灾难
  • 可配合ls -lt | head快速定位最新生成的图(如042.png

3.2 按时间范围批量删除(适合定期清理)

假设你想删除“三天前生成的所有图”,可借助find命令:

# 删除 3 天前的所有 PNG 文件(谨慎!建议先用 -print 测试) find ~/workspace/output_image/ -name "*.png" -mtime +3 -print # 确认无误后执行删除(去掉 -print,加上 -delete) find ~/workspace/output_image/ -name "*.png" -mtime +3 -delete

关键参数说明:

  • -mtime +3:修改时间超过 3 天(即 72 小时以上)
  • -name "*.png":严格限定类型,避免误删日志等非图片文件
  • -print:仅打印匹配路径,不执行删除(测试必加!)

优势:自动化程度高,适合定时任务(如crontab每日凌晨清理)
注意:-mtime基于“天”而非“小时”,若需精确到小时,请用-mmin +4320(4320 分钟 = 3 天)

3.3 彻底清空目录(慎用!仅限重置环境)

当目录混乱、文件名无序、或你想从零开始时:

# 方法一:进入目录后清空(推荐,路径明确) cd ~/workspace/output_image/ rm -rf * # 方法二:一行命令(确保路径绝对正确!) rm -rf ~/workspace/output_image/*

❗ 极其重要提醒:

  • rm -rf *中的*是通配符,会匹配目录下所有非隐藏文件
  • 它不会删除.gitignore.env等以.开头的隐藏文件(安全)
  • 但若你不小心在错误目录执行(如/root/),后果不可逆!
    最佳实践:执行前永远先运行pwd确认当前路径,并用ls查看*匹配结果。

4. 预防性管理建议:让历史更有序

与其事后清理,不如事前规范。以下三个小习惯,能显著降低管理成本:

4.1 为每次生成添加语义化前缀

Z-Image-Turbo_UI 支持在生成时指定文件名前缀(如cat_logo_product_)。这比默认的001.png实用百倍:

  • 在单图生成页,填写「文件名前缀」框:product_red_bottle_
  • 生成结果自动命名为product_red_bottle_001.pngproduct_red_bottle_002.png
  • 后续用ls product*即可一键列出所有产品图

提示:前缀中避免空格和特殊符号(如#,$,&),可用下划线_或连字符-分隔词。

4.2 建立子目录分类(无需改代码)

Gradio 默认不支持子目录,但你可以手动创建并软链接:

# 创建分类目录 mkdir -p ~/workspace/output_image/products/ mkdir -p ~/workspace/output_image/avatars/ # 将默认输出目录软链接到当前常用分类(切换只需改链接) ln -sfv ~/workspace/output_image/products/ ~/workspace/output_image/current # 此后所有生成图自动落入 products/ 子目录

虽然 UI 画廊仍显示全部,但终端操作(如ls products/)变得极清晰。

4.3 定期导出重要图片到外部存储

对于已确认满意的作品,不要长期留在output_image/

# 创建归档目录(带日期,便于追溯) mkdir -p ~/workspace/archive/20250128_product_shots/ # 批量复制(保留原名) cp ~/workspace/output_image/product_* ~/workspace/archive/20250128_product_shots/ # 清理原目录中已归档的文件(-v 显示过程,更安心) rm -fv ~/workspace/output_image/product_*

效果:output_image/保持轻量,核心作品有独立备份,且路径自带时间戳。


5. 常见问题与避坑指南

实际使用中,以下问题高频出现。我们给出直接、可执行的答案,而非模糊建议。

5.1 问题:UI 画廊里看不到最新生成的图?

原因:Gradio 画廊采用启动时缓存机制,不会实时监听文件系统变化。
解决:点击画廊页的「 刷新历史」按钮,或重启 Gradio 服务(Ctrl+C停止后重新运行python /Z-Image-Turbo_gradio_ui.py)。

5.2 问题:rm -rf *删除后,ls还显示文件?

原因:你可能在错误路径执行了命令,或*未匹配到任何文件(目录为空或只有隐藏文件)。
验证:执行pwd看当前路径;执行ls -la看是否含隐藏文件(.xxx);执行echo *看通配符展开结果。

5.3 问题:想删除某类图(如所有 512x512 尺寸的),但文件名不含尺寸信息?

现实方案:Z-Image-Turbo_UI 默认不将尺寸写入文件名。此时应转向图像元数据提取:

# 安装 exiftool(如未预装) apt-get update && apt-get install -y exiftool # 查看某张图的尺寸 exiftool -ImageSize ~/workspace/output_image/001.png # 批量筛选并列出 512x512 的图(需配合脚本,此处为思路) for f in ~/workspace/output_image/*.png; do size=$(exiftool -s -ImageSize "$f" 2>/dev/null | cut -d: -f2 | tr -d ' ') if [ "$size" = "512x512" ]; then echo "$f"; fi done

注意:此方法依赖exiftool,且部分 PNG 可能无尺寸元数据。更推荐事前用前缀管理(如512x512_cat_)。

5.4 问题:删除后磁盘空间没释放?

原因:文件被进程占用(如图片正被浏览器标签页打开、或 Gradio 缓存未释放)。
解决

# 查找占用该文件的进程(以 001.png 为例) lsof ~/workspace/output_image/001.png # 若有结果,重启相关进程(通常是浏览器或 python 进程) pkill -f "Z-Image-Turbo"

6. 总结:建立属于你的图片管理节奏

Z-Image-Turbo_UI 的历史图片管理,本质是一场人与工具的协作优化

  • 工具提供稳定路径(~/workspace/output_image/)和原生画廊(“生成历史”Tab)
  • 人则需建立简单规则:加前缀、分目录、勤归档、慎删除

你不需要记住所有命令,只需掌握三个核心动作:
1⃣ls -t ~/workspace/output_image/ | head -n 5—— 3 秒确认最新图
2⃣:浏览器打开http://localhost:7860→ “生成历史” —— 直观预览与定位
3⃣cd ~/workspace/output_image/ && rm -f target_name.png—— 精准清除,不留隐患

当生成越来越频繁,管理就不再是负担,而成为创作流程中自然的一环。那些曾让你皱眉的“找图难”“删图慌”,终将变成指尖轻点的从容。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/3 6:20:50

GLM-4.7-Flash详细步骤:修改max-model-len至4096并验证上下文连贯性

GLM-4.7-Flash详细步骤:修改max-model-len至4096并验证上下文连贯性 1. 为什么需要调整max-model-len?从实际需求说起 你有没有遇到过这样的情况:和GLM-4.7-Flash聊着聊着,它突然“忘了”前面说了什么?或者输入一段3…

作者头像 李华
网站建设 2026/3/28 22:54:30

WS2812B时序控制深度剖析与驱动设计

以下是对您提供的博文《WS2812B时序控制深度剖析与驱动设计》的 全面润色与专业重构版本 。本次优化严格遵循您的全部要求: ✅ 彻底去除AI痕迹,语言自然、老练、有“人味”,像一位十年嵌入式老兵在技术社区掏心窝子分享; ✅ 打…

作者头像 李华
网站建设 2026/4/2 12:26:44

一键部署WAN2.2文生视频:SDXL_Prompt风格快速入门指南

一键部署WAN2.2文生视频:SDXL_Prompt风格快速入门指南 你有没有试过这样的情景?刚在脑中构思好一段短视频脚本——“清晨的江南古镇,青石板路泛着微光,一位穿蓝印花布旗袍的姑娘撑着油纸伞走过拱桥,白鹭掠过黛瓦飞檐”…

作者头像 李华
网站建设 2026/3/27 17:48:12

StructBERT语义匹配系统安全特性详解:全链路本地化与零数据外泄

StructBERT语义匹配系统安全特性详解:全链路本地化与零数据外泄 1. 为什么语义匹配需要“真安全”? 你有没有遇到过这样的情况:把两段完全不相关的中文文本——比如“苹果手机发布会”和“香蕉种植技术手册”——扔进某个在线语义相似度工具…

作者头像 李华
网站建设 2026/4/2 23:45:28

语音情绪识别结果可视化!科哥镜像输出JSON和npy文件详解

语音情绪识别结果可视化!科哥镜像输出JSON和npy文件详解 在实际语音情感分析项目中,模型输出的原始数据如何被真正“用起来”,往往比模型本身更关键。很多开发者拿到result.json和embedding.npy后,第一反应是:这俩文件…

作者头像 李华
网站建设 2026/3/31 20:57:32

实测Flash Attention加速效果:YOLOv12性能揭秘

实测Flash Attention加速效果:YOLOv12性能揭秘 在目标检测模型迭代进入“注意力驱动”新纪元的当下,一个名字正迅速引起工业界和学术圈的共同关注——YOLOv12。它不再沿用YOLO系列惯用的CNN主干,而是首次将注意力机制作为核心建模单元&#…

作者头像 李华